Cracked Basement Floor Repair in Tampa, FL
Cracked basement floor repair services address issues related to damage or deterioration in the concrete slabs of a basement. This type of repair is commonly needed when cracks develop due to settling, shifting soil, or moisture-related problems. Projects can include filling and sealing existing cracks, restoring uneven or sunken areas, and strengthening the foundation to prevent further damage. Homeowners often seek this service to improve safety, prevent water intrusion, and protect the structural integrity of their property.
Before requesting cracked basement floor repair, property owners typically want to understand the extent of the damage and the underlying causes. It’s important to assess whether cracks are superficial or indicative of more serious foundation issues. Additionally, understanding the repair process, including the materials used and the expected results, can help in making informed decisions. Proper evaluation ensures that the repair addresses both the visible cracks and any contributing factors, supporting a durable and lasting solution.

Common Cracked Basement Floor Repair Jobs
Cracked Basement Floor Repair - addresses surface cracks to prevent further damage and maintain structural integrity.
Foundation Crack Sealing - seals small to large cracks that can lead to water infiltration and basement flooding.
Concrete Leveling and Stabilization - restores uneven floors caused by shifting or settling soil beneath the slab.
Waterproofing Solutions - applies barriers to keep moisture out and protect the basement from water damage.
Slab Replacement - removes and replaces severely damaged or cracked sections of the basement floor.
Crack Injection Services - injects specialized materials into cracks to reinforce and prevent future expansion.
Cracked Basement Floor Repair Questions
What causes cracks in basement floors? Cracks often result from soil settling, moisture changes, or concrete curing issues that create stress on the slab.
Are cracks in the basement floor a sign of structural problems? Small cracks are common and usually not a sign of major issues, but larger or expanding cracks may indicate underlying movement.
Can cracked basement floors be repaired without replacing the entire slab? Yes, repairs typically involve sealing cracks or filling voids to restore stability and prevent further damage.
What methods are used to repair cracked basement floors? Common methods include epoxy injections, polyurethane foam filling, and concrete patching to reinforce and seal cracks effectively.
